ésam Caen/Cherbourg: Laboratoire Modulaire Research Residency

Research on the various perceptual, aesthetic and sociological processes involved in the new forms intuitions can take. Deadline: February 24, 2023.

The higher education institution ésam Caen/Cherbourg is inviting applicants for an artistic research residency in 2023-2024 at the Laboratoire Modulaire.

Initiated in 2019, the Laboratoire Modulaire intends to question the notion of ‘spatialisation’ by exploring the constantly evolving relationships between digital devices and the design of spaces: immersive environments (sound or visual), virtual reality, augmented reality, crossed reality… Its aim is to design new forms of sensitive interaction within physical, virtual, and hybrid spaces in order to create environments, ecosystems, and digital territories involving the body.

The call is aimed at artists conducting research related to the issues raised by Laboratoire Modulaire and working on digital practices and technologies. A public presentation of the project will be expected at the end of the residency.

The artist-researcher will participate in Laboratoire Modulaire’s activities: meetings with the team, artistic and research events, invitations to artists, theoreticians, researchers, etc. He/she/they will also have the opportunity to be part of the organisation of such activities.

The residency is dedicated to the implementation of a research project. However, because of the close links between research and pedagogy of an art school, pedagogical interventions may take place and will be the subject of a specific agreement.

The research residency will run from autumn 2023 to autumn 2024. It is provided with a grant of 10,000 euros which includes remuneration, production costs, transport, and per diems (it will be paid in two installments, two-thirds at the beginning of the residency, one-third at the beginning of 2024).

The organisation and schedule of the residency will be agreed upon at the beginning of its implementation. A regular presence will be expected, representing at least the equivalent of eight weeks. Accommodation is possible, subject to availability in the school.

ésam Caen/Cherbourg will provide the researcher with a workspace and will facilitate access to all its equipment (within the framework of their operating procedures), as well as to Le Dôme FabLab. ésam Caen/Cherbourg is committed to ensuring the communication of the project and supporting the researcher in his/her/their search for new partners.

The application must include:

  • a one to two-page proposal presenting the research project and proposed activities during the residency
  • a curriculum vitae
  • a portfolio (pdf file of 20 MB maximum and/or link to a website)
  • any other document necessary for understanding the project
  • a provisional timetable.

Applications must be submitted using the form before the 24th of February, 2023.
